Ah, the lovable mischief-maker Ty Segall is back at it again with his latest album, "Sleeper." This time around, Segall takes a more subdued approach, trading in his trademark fuzz for a more introspective sound. The album kicks off with the dreamy title track, setting the tone for the rest of the record. Segall's signature vocals pierce through the hazy instrumentation, drawing listeners in with his raw emotion and storytelling prowess. Tracks like "The Keepers" and "She Don't Care" showcase Segall's ability to blend catchy melodies with poignant lyrical content. His songwriting is as sharp as ever, touching on themes of love, loss, and existential dread. But don't be fooled by the laid-back vibes of "Sleeper." Segall still manages to pack a punch with tracks like "The Man Man," where his guitar skills take center stage and remind us why he's a force to be reckoned with in the indie rock scene. Overall, "Sleeper" is a masterful display of Ty Segall's versatility as an artist. Whether he's shredding on guitar or crooning a heartfelt ballad, Segall proves once again why he's one of the most exciting musicians in the game.
